Output 80d86472ce96e76065c2ae0f3251357b5c03cc7f4acb969946776e005209736d:0

value
648206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da07c5d573522a1141185d11a03b6ce0143127ec OP_EQUAL
address
3MZrYRduXaSVV9jJA3WzhnvymLJ2J4bwuU
transaction
80d86472ce96e76065c2ae0f3251357b5c03cc7f4acb969946776e005209736d
confirmations
336760
spent
true